VIDEO : Evacuation call as heavy floods drench Japan city

Residents of the Japanese metropolis of Hamamatsu have been urged to evacuate on Friday after heavy rains precipitated the Magome river to burst its banks.

The Japan Meteorological Company issued heavy rain warnings for Shizuoka Prefecture, the place Hamamatsu is situated.

At 1300 native time (0400 GMT), the company recorded 118 millimeters (4.6 inches) of rain within the Hamakita space of Hamamatsu.

Footage from Japanese TV confirmed streets submerged beneath floodwater. Metropolis authorities urged residents to take motion to guard their lives and established evacuation websites.
